-rw-r--r-- | korganizer/koagendaitem.h |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/korganizer/koagendaitem.h b/korganizer/koagendaitem.h index d1b1940..dc2316a 100644 --- a/korganizer/koagendaitem.h +++ b/korganizer/koagendaitem.h | |||
@@ -80,64 +80,65 @@ class KOAgendaItem : public QWidget | |||
80 | void setMultiItem(KOAgendaItem *first,KOAgendaItem *next, | 80 | void setMultiItem(KOAgendaItem *first,KOAgendaItem *next, |
81 | KOAgendaItem *last); | 81 | KOAgendaItem *last); |
82 | KOAgendaItem *firstMultiItem() { return mFirstMultiItem; } | 82 | KOAgendaItem *firstMultiItem() { return mFirstMultiItem; } |
83 | KOAgendaItem *nextMultiItem() { return mNextMultiItem; } | 83 | KOAgendaItem *nextMultiItem() { return mNextMultiItem; } |
84 | KOAgendaItem *lastMultiItem() { return mLastMultiItem; } | 84 | KOAgendaItem *lastMultiItem() { return mLastMultiItem; } |
85 | 85 | ||
86 | Incidence *incidence() const { return mIncidence; } | 86 | Incidence *incidence() const { return mIncidence; } |
87 | QDate itemDate() { return mDate; } | 87 | QDate itemDate() { return mDate; } |
88 | 88 | ||
89 | /** Update the date of this item's occurence (not in the event) */ | 89 | /** Update the date of this item's occurence (not in the event) */ |
90 | void setItemDate(QDate qd); | 90 | void setItemDate(QDate qd); |
91 | 91 | ||
92 | void setText ( const QString & text ) { mDisplayedText = text; } | 92 | void setText ( const QString & text ) { mDisplayedText = text; } |
93 | QString text () { return mDisplayedText; } | 93 | QString text () { return mDisplayedText; } |
94 | 94 | ||
95 | virtual bool eventFilter ( QObject *, QEvent * ); | 95 | virtual bool eventFilter ( QObject *, QEvent * ); |
96 | 96 | ||
97 | static QToolTipGroup *toolTipGroup(); | 97 | static QToolTipGroup *toolTipGroup(); |
98 | 98 | ||
99 | QPtrList<KOAgendaItem> conflictItems(); | 99 | QPtrList<KOAgendaItem> conflictItems(); |
100 | void setConflictItems(QPtrList<KOAgendaItem>); | 100 | void setConflictItems(QPtrList<KOAgendaItem>); |
101 | void addConflictItem(KOAgendaItem *ci); | 101 | void addConflictItem(KOAgendaItem *ci); |
102 | void paintMe( bool, QPainter* painter = 0 ); | 102 | void paintMe( bool, QPainter* painter = 0 ); |
103 | void repaintMe(); | 103 | void repaintMe(); |
104 | static void resizePixmap( int, int ); | 104 | static void resizePixmap( int, int ); |
105 | static QPixmap * paintPix(); | 105 | static QPixmap * paintPix(); |
106 | static QPixmap * paintPixSel(); | 106 | static QPixmap * paintPixSel(); |
107 | static QPixmap * paintPixAllday(); | 107 | static QPixmap * paintPixAllday(); |
108 | void updateItem(); | 108 | void updateItem(); |
109 | void computeText(); | 109 | void computeText(); |
110 | void recreateIncidence(); | 110 | void recreateIncidence(); |
111 | bool checkLayout(); | 111 | bool checkLayout(); |
112 | void initColor (); | ||
112 | public slots: | 113 | public slots: |
113 | bool updateIcons( QPainter *, bool ); | 114 | bool updateIcons( QPainter *, bool ); |
114 | void select(bool=true); | 115 | void select(bool=true); |
115 | 116 | ||
116 | protected: | 117 | protected: |
117 | void dragEnterEvent(QDragEnterEvent *e); | 118 | void dragEnterEvent(QDragEnterEvent *e); |
118 | void dropEvent(QDropEvent *e); | 119 | void dropEvent(QDropEvent *e); |
119 | void paintEvent ( QPaintEvent * ); | 120 | void paintEvent ( QPaintEvent * ); |
120 | void resizeEvent ( QResizeEvent *ev ); | 121 | void resizeEvent ( QResizeEvent *ev ); |
121 | 122 | ||
122 | private: | 123 | private: |
123 | KOAgendaItemWhatsThis* mKOAgendaItemWhatsThis; | 124 | KOAgendaItemWhatsThis* mKOAgendaItemWhatsThis; |
124 | bool mAllDay; | 125 | bool mAllDay; |
125 | bool mWhiteText; | 126 | bool mWhiteText; |
126 | int mCellX; | 127 | int mCellX; |
127 | int mCellXWidth; | 128 | int mCellXWidth; |
128 | int mCellYTop,mCellYBottom; | 129 | int mCellYTop,mCellYBottom; |
129 | int mSubCell; // subcell number of this item | 130 | int mSubCell; // subcell number of this item |
130 | int mSubCells; // Total number of subcells in cell of this item | 131 | int mSubCells; // Total number of subcells in cell of this item |
131 | int xPaintCoord; | 132 | int xPaintCoord; |
132 | int yPaintCoord; | 133 | int yPaintCoord; |
133 | int wPaintCoord; | 134 | int wPaintCoord; |
134 | int hPaintCoord; | 135 | int hPaintCoord; |
135 | // Variables to remember start position | 136 | // Variables to remember start position |
136 | int mStartCellX; | 137 | int mStartCellX; |
137 | int mStartCellXWidth; | 138 | int mStartCellXWidth; |
138 | int mStartCellYTop,mStartCellYBottom; | 139 | int mStartCellYTop,mStartCellYBottom; |
139 | int mLastMovePos; | 140 | int mLastMovePos; |
140 | 141 | ||
141 | // Multi item pointers | 142 | // Multi item pointers |
142 | KOAgendaItem *mFirstMultiItem; | 143 | KOAgendaItem *mFirstMultiItem; |
143 | KOAgendaItem *mNextMultiItem; | 144 | KOAgendaItem *mNextMultiItem; |